Amazombie Posted January 14, 2020 Share Posted January 14, 2020 One of the things i really miss now that mods are being done is the qol improvements. So I'd like to see some of them added. I'm sure some modders would even help hinterland if they needed. 1. stacking and rotating objects. so much easier to organize your stash if you can do this 2. shorter reading intervals 3. break down cans for scrap metal 4. clean up ground trash, again, just made things look nicer. I like the changes in the current release , the only thing holding me back and using the last one is the mods. Guest jeffpeng Posted January 15, 2020 Share Posted January 15, 2020 13 hours ago, Amazombie said: 1. stacking and rotating objects. so much easier to organize your stash if you can do this Please. 13 hours ago, Amazombie said: 2. shorter reading intervals Please. 13 hours ago, Amazombie said: 3. break down cans for scrap metal Nah. Too easy source of already abundant scrap metal imho. That's not really QoL, that's actually messing with the game's balance. 13 hours ago, Amazombie said: 4. clean up ground trash, again, just made things look nicer. Please. I also liked that you could move some chairs / armchairs around / pick them up from the floor and fix broken containers like cabinets and drawers. In general I really would like so see a few things to make "living" nicer without upsetting game balance. It sometimes gets dull on day 300, so a bit of redecorating would be nice. Silverhour Posted January 16, 2020 Share Posted January 16, 2020 Expanding the menu would be nice too, I think. The food pack mod was really well put together, and it didn't increase the amount of food in the game, just changed what was available. The Statuettes mod was a nice way to pass time and create decorations, as was finding and playing the guitar and harmonica in the instruments mod. None of these broke or unbalanced the game, but definitely improved the way it was played.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
